Business Facilities Magazine Honors LVEDC and Bethlehem Steel for Bethlehem Works/Bethlehem Commerce Center Plan

    January 5, 2001, Lehigh Valley, Pa - The Lehigh Valley Economic Development Corporation has received the Business Facilities' Gold level award in the Corporate Citizenship Award category on behalf of Bethlehem Works and Bethlehem Commerce Center developments being led by Bethlehem Steel Corporation.

    The first-place award, which judges a project on the basis of innovation, effectiveness and the pro-business impact, honors companies that have actively and measurably participated in a regional development effort. Bethlehem Works and Bethlehem Commerce Center were nominated by LVEDC, which submitted the award on their behalf.

    Business Facilities' Annual Achievement Award program is a national competition that brings recognition to an elite group of progressive leaders, benchmarks their achievements and sets the standard by which others follow. Business Facilities' editors, along with a panel of site selectors, judged the entries.

    Donna Clapp, editor of Business Facilities Magazine, congratulated LVEDC and Bethlehem Steel by saying, "The Bethlehem Commerce Center and Bethlehem Works Community Revitalization Plan truly captures how a public-private partnership can innovatively improve an entire community."

    Duane R. Dunham, chairman, president and chief executive officer, Bethlehem Steel Corporation, said, "Bethlehem Steel is proud of its past contributions to our namesake city and very proud of this first place award for this project that will contribute significantly to the course of the City's future. "Leading the creation of a public/private partnership is our commitment to the future of the City of Bethlehem and the entire Lehigh Valley region. Good citizenship is a principal objective of Bethlehem Steel, and nowhere is it better illustrated than here at Bethlehem Works and Bethlehem Commerce Center in Bethlehem, Pa."

    Last year, LVEDC received honorable mention in the Regional Economic Development Incentive program category. In addition to being an award recipient, LVEDC and Bethlehem Works and Bethlehem Commerce Center are among a list of winners honored in the December issue of Business Facilities.

    As a private, non-profit corporation, LVEDC is a regional economic development marketing organization, offering businesses and industries one unified source for information about the Lehigh Valley. Through award-winning publications, like Business Facilities, the LVEDC communicates the many benefits of the Lehigh Valley region to businesses looking to expand and/or relocate.

    Bethlehem Steel Corporation is the nation's second-largest fully integrated steel company with revenues of about $4 billion and shipments of nine million tons of steel products. Bethlehem's 14,500 employees work primarily in three major divisions -- Burns Harbor, Ind.; Sparrows Point, Md. (with plate mills in Coatesville and Conshohocken, Pa.); and Pennsylvania Steel Technologies, Steelton, Pa. The corporation is a leading supplier to North American automotive industry and construction industries, and is the largest supplier of plate products on the continent.
